Correct answer: every action there is an equal and opposite reaction.213. Oil rises up to wick in a lamp because_____________?
- A. Oil is very light
- B. Oil is volatile
- C. Diffusion of oil through the wick
- D. Capillary action phenomenon
Explanation: Liquid oil climbs through the narrow pores of a wick because of capillary action, produced by adhesion to the wick and cohesion within the oil. Its lightness or volatility is not the cause.

Correct answer: It does not carry any charge215. The absolute value of charge on electron was determined by ________ ?
- A. J.J.Thomson
- B. Chadwick
- C. Rutherford
- D. Robert Millikan
Explanation: Robert Millikan determined the electron's charge magnitude through his oil-drop experiment. J. J. Thomson measured the charge-to-mass ratio, not the absolute charge alone.

Correct answer: Giorgi217. Hydrogen bomb is based on the principle of ________ ?
- A. Nuclear fusion
- B. Artificial radioactivity
- C. Natural radioactivity
- D. Nuclear fission
Explanation: A hydrogen bomb releases energy through nuclear fusion, in which light hydrogen nuclei combine to form heavier nuclei. Nuclear fission may be used as a trigger, but it is not the main principle of the hydrogen bomb.
